Responsibilities

  • Perform on‑site inspections of solar PV installations to verify construction quality and compliance with established procedures.
  • Carry out visual and electrical checks following standardized testing protocols.
  • Review and validate field measurement data, test procedures, and basic test reports to ensure consistency with site conditions.
  • Identify, document, and follow up on deviations, defects, or safety concerns until they are resolved.
  • Participate in site coordination meetings to communicate findings and ensure all required documentation is provided by stakeholders.
  • Support the collection and preliminary review of PR measurements, IV curve data, and other performance indicators.
  • Assist with field testing activities such as electroluminescence (EL) imaging, thermographic inspections, curve tracing, insulation resistance testing, and general visual inspections.
  • Operate, maintain, and properly handle testing equipment including IV tracers, EL cameras, insulation resistance meters, infrared cameras, clamp meters, and multimeters.
  • Coordinate with client representatives and contractors prior to and during site visits to ensure readiness for testing activities.
  • Contribute to the preparation of field notes and provide input to final inspection reports to confirm that results match field observations.
